Perkasie Borough Council advances traffic calming measures on Blooming Glen
PERKASIE — The Perkasie Borough Council advanced an ordinance to establish numerous traffic calming measures on West Blooming Glen Drive. The ordinance comes on the heels of the planned resurfacing of Blooming Glen Drive, set to begin next week. Changes include the relocation of the North 7th Street crosswalk to the upper school driveway and the establishment of no parking zones above the lower school driveway. Township engineer Doug Rossino added that the lower driveway’s left turning lane will be reduced to provide more street parking.

Police find dead puppies on Chester County golf course
Seven dead puppies were found on a Chester County golf course Monday. Police are investigating who left the dogs there. Caln Township police officers found the puppies near the 9th hole of the Ingleside Golf Club, in Thorndale, police said. The puppies, all pit bull terrier mixes that appear to be from the same litter, were found about 130 yards off the US Route 30 bypass, police said.

Twins beat Phillies 7-2 as Bailey Ober shines after shaky start
After a 91-minute rain delay Monday, Bailey Ober had the Twins in a two-run hole after facing his first three batters. Ober apparently had the Philadelphia Phillies, the team with the best record in the majors, right where he wanted them. He received an ovation when he walked off the mound in the seventh inning and he received a congratulatory handshake after he delivered one of his finest starts of the season in a 7-2 victory at Target Field.
